Compact Bio-Wearable Device PCB & Firmware Development
Budget: $30 – $250 USD
I'm developing a compact bio-wearable device for health monitoring and need technical expertise to finalize the build. This project involves working on several crucial components, including PCB design, firmware development, and ensuring manufacturability. ($0 - $100)
Key Requirements:
- Design a production-ready PCB (Gerber + BOM).
- Implement basic firmware that can be open source for sensor data collection and BLE transmission and data should be transmitted to an app
- Integrate pogo pin charging if feasible.
- Ensure readiness for manufacturing and test assembly.
The device will include the following sensors:
- Heart Rate Sensor
- Oxygen Sensor
- 3-Axis Accelerometer
- Power/Pairing Button
Ideal Skills & Experience:
- Proficient in PCB design and firmware development.
- Experience with BLE communication.
- Attention to compact design and ease of manufacture.
